Celebs lend support to Hania Aamir amid criticism
Karachi: Many celebrities lent support to Pakistan's acclaimed Lollywood star Hania Amir, after she came under severe criticism when her video went viral on social media.

As per details, Hania Aamir became the target of trolls after a now-deleted video posted by her sparked controversy. The video showed her lying over Aashir Wajahat with Nayel Wajahat by her side.
The video received a lot of criticism from the netizens.
Many celebrities including Fahad Mustafa, Ali Zafar, Mirza Gohar and Shahveer Jafry backed Hania- have a look.

Hania Amir started her acting career from the film Janaan and is among those celebrities who got fame and success in a really short time.
Later the actress worked for famous commercial brands, drama, and film Projects.
Some of her famous works include highest-grossing films like ‘Na Maloom Afraad 2 and ‘Parwaaz hai Junoon’ along with some famous TV serials including ‘Titli’, ‘Visaal’, ‘Ishqiya’ and many more.
